Output 5a3944a5fc4580bc5009b835586ed59e0cb30b896f140fce491ad2be4cea5e8d:1

value
172742234
script pubkey
OP_0 OP_PUSHBYTES_20 1a90621c1b5dc76430578988a682de6d78daa21a
address
bc1qr2gxy8qmthrkgvzh3xy2dqk7d4ud4gs6f4vztc
transaction
5a3944a5fc4580bc5009b835586ed59e0cb30b896f140fce491ad2be4cea5e8d
confirmations
166566
spent
true